## Data Stores — Parcelhawk Webhook

Quick rundown for reviewers: the Parcelhawk webhook receiver writes every inbound scan event to the `scan_events` table before any dedupe happens, so don't be alarmed by duplicates upstream of the consolidator. Retention is 30 days, then a nightly job sweeps old rows. The dedupe worker and the reporting jobs both read from the same replica, which keeps load predictable. If you want to poke at the data locally, use the connection string below.

replica DSN, kajep-yahag: mssql://praok_svc:iF@db-8d68.plorvaio.local:5432/eliion

Welcome to on-call for the Glimmerpane design system! Our snapshot tests live in the `snapcheck` suite and run on every merge to main. If a UI component changes visually, the diff bot flags it — usually it's an intentional tweak, so just approve the new baseline. If it's 2am and snapshots are failing across the board, it's almost always a font-loading race, not your problem. To unlock the baseline store and re-approve snapshots in bulk, use the recovery passphrase below.

recovery phrase for tahag-taguf: wenix-caswyn

Quarterly Planning Note — Divestiture of the Coastal Tooling Unit

For the finance team: the sale of the Coastal Tooling unit to Pellmark Industries remains on track for close in Q3. Please finalize the carve-out balance sheet, reconcile intercompany positions, and prepare the working-capital adjustment schedule by month-end. Audit support requests should be prioritized. For planning purposes, note the following sensitive item:

internal memo for hawef-kahif: The finance team signed off on a budget of $25.9 million for Project Sorox. The renewal with Pelokek Logistics closes at $51.7 million a year, 52 percent below the last contract.